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Fort Myers offers mild, dry, and sunny conditions, with average daytime temperatures in the low 70s Fahrenheit. Evenings can be cool, often dropping into the 50s, so packing a light jacket or sweater is advisable. This is prime golf season, and the comfortable weather makes it ideal for long days on the course without the intense heat of summer.

🌱

Spring & early summer

As spring progresses into early summer, temperatures begin to climb, reaching the high 80s and low 90s Fahrenheit. Humidity also starts to increase, making outdoor activities feel warmer. Expect occasional afternoon thunderstorms, which can be brief but intense. Lightweight, breathable clothing is essential, and staying hydrated becomes increasingly important.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er in Fort Myers is characterized by high heat and humidity, with daytime temperatures consistently in the low to mid-90s Fahrenheit. Daily afternoon thunderstorms are common, often providing temporary relief from the heat. Golfing during these months requires careful planning to avoid the peak heat, such as early morning tee times, and continuous hydration is crucial.

🍂

Fall season

The fall season brings a gradual cooling trend, with temperatures slowly decreasing from summer highs. By late fall, the weather becomes increasingly pleasant, with daytime highs in the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it and less humidity. This period offers excellent conditions for golf and outdoor activities, making it a popular time to visit before the winter season’s peak.

📅

Rain & snow

Fort Myers experiences rain primarily during the summer months as part of its tropical wet and dry climate pattern, with afternoon downpours being typical. Snow is virtually nonexistent in this region. When rain occurs during cooler months, it tends to be less intense and shorter-lived than summer storms, but can still impact outdoor plans, making indoor dining or a visit to a local attraction a good alternative.
